Understanding Outdoor Antennas and Their Functionality
Outdoor antennas are devices specifically designed to receive television signals transmitted over the airwaves. These antennas operate by capturing radio frequency signals broadcasted from television stations, converting them into electronic signals that a TV can interpret. Unlike indoor antennas, which are limited by signal obstruction from walls and furniture, outdoor antennas can significantly enhance reception due to their elevated placement and broader exposure to the surrounding environment.
One of the key advantages of outdoor antennas is their ability to receive a diverse range of frequencies. Television signals can be classified into two categories: analog and digital. While analog signals are being phased out, many areas still receive analog broadcasts in addition to digital signals. Outdoor antennas are particularly adept at capturing these signals as they are designed to handle a wider spectrum of frequencies compared to their indoor counterparts. This increased range allows users to access more channels and improves overall reception quality.
Several factors influence the effectiveness of outdoor antennas in picking up broadcast signals. Location plays a crucial role, as the proximity to transmission towers can greatly enhance signal strength. Additionally, terrain features such as hills, tall buildings, and vegetation may obstruct signals, necessitating proper antenna placement for optimal performance. For instance, positioning the antenna higher, away from obstructions, can yield better results. Moreover, the antenna’s design and model will also affect reception capabilities, with some antennas being tailored to capture specific ranges of frequencies more effectively than others.

Factors to Consider When Choosing an Outdoor Antenna
When selecting an outdoor antenna, several essential factors can influence your decision and ultimately affect the quality of television reception. Understanding these factors will allow you to choose an outdoor antenna that best meets your needs, thus improving your viewing experience.
First and foremost, consider the type of antenna that suits your requirements. Directional antennas are designed to pick up signals from one specific direction, making them ideal for areas where broadcast towers are located in a single direction. Conversely, omnidirectional antennas can receive signals from multiple directions, allowing for greater flexibility, especially in regions with multiple tower locations. Depending on your individual circumstances, the type of antenna you choose can significantly impact your reception capabilities.
Another critical factor is the antenna’s range, which refers to how far it can effectively receive signals from broadcast towers. Ranges can vary significantly, with some antennas targeting a distance of 30 miles while others can reach 100 miles or more. Factors such as terrain, the presence of obstacles, and the antenna’s height will also play a vital role in determining the effective range, making it important to assess these conditions in your specific location.
Compatibility with digital broadcasting standards is equally important. Ensure that the outdoor antenna you choose supports ATSC (Advanced Television Systems Committee) standards, which are essential for receiving high-definition digital broadcasts. This consideration ensures a higher quality signal and better picture clarity.
Additionally, installation requirements and local broadcast tower locations should be assessed. Some antennas may require professional installation, while others can be set up relatively easily by the user. Lastly, take into account the weather resistance of the antenna, as it needs to withstand various elements over time. Installation Tips for Maximizing TV Reception
Installing an outdoor antenna effectively is crucial for obtaining the best possible television reception. The placement of the antenna can significantly influence reception quality, and several factors should be considered during installation. First and foremost, selecting an ideal mounting location is essential. Ideally, the antenna should be installed at a height that maximizes exposure to signal waves while being free from nearby obstructions. Elevated installations can help avoid interference from buildings, trees, or other obstacles that can block signals.
When deciding on elevation, it is advisable to mount the antenna on rooftops or high on poles. The higher the antenna, the better the potential for a clearer signal, especially in regions with challenging topography. Additionally, it is recommended to face the antenna towards the nearest broadcast tower. Checking tools and websites that provide the direction of local towers can be beneficial for achieving optimal alignment.
Avoiding signal obstructions is another critical aspect of installation. Before permanently mounting the antenna, it’s wise to conduct tests in various positions to identify where the signal strength is highest. In some cases, it may also be beneficial to use a rotor that allows users to adjust antenna direction from indoors, optimizing reception without needing to go outside repeatedly.
If reception issues occur post-installation, troubleshooting can help identify the problem. Ensure that all cables are securely connected and free of damage. If issues persist, consider using a signal amplifier or booster, especially in areas with weak signals. These devices can significantly enhance the strength of the signal, making a noticeable difference in viewing quality.
